A criminal case of a terrorist act has been opened over the shelling of the village of Korenevo in Kursk Region by the Armed Forces of Ukraine (AFU). This was reported on February 16 in the main military investigation directorate (GVSU) of the Investigative Committee (IC) of Russia.
"A criminal case has been opened in connection with the commission by armed formations of Ukraine of a terrorist act against the peaceful population of Kursk region (paragraphs "a", "c" of part 2 of article 205 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ation)", - stated in the Telegram-channel of the department.
The SCSU stressed that the AFU had committed a targeted shelling of the village, where civilians live. The agency promised to identify all those involved and bring them to justice.
On February 15, a civilian was injured during the AFU shelling of the village of Korenevo in Kursk region. A 67-year-old man was hit in the courtyard of his house. The victim was taken to hospital.
